Healthcare is at an inflection point where ambient AI documentation, autonomous coding engines, and clinical decision agents are reshaping every layer of the workforce. The challenge is not whether to adopt AI, but how to restructure roles around it without compromising patient outcomes. What is accelerating AI adoption in Healthcare
Multimodal AI systems now capture physician-patient encounters and produce structured clinical notes in real time, eliminating hours of manual documentation and reshaping the entire clinical documentation specialist role around quality assurance and exception management.
Agentic AI workflows now handle coding, charge capture, claim submission, and denial follow-up with minimal human intervention. Revenue cycle teams are shifting from processing to strategic oversight and payer relationship management.
AI systems that fuse imaging, lab results, genomics, and clinical notes to recommend diagnoses and treatment pathways are transforming clinical workflows. Clinicians are becoming decision validators working with AI-generated care recommendations.
AI-powered patient agents handle appointment management, medication adherence outreach, and pre-visit intake autonomously. Care coordinators now focus exclusively on complex transitions and high-acuity patients requiring human judgment.
